Drain field installation services involve setting up the underground system responsible for dispersing wastewater from a septic tank into the soil. This process typically includes preparing the site, excavating trenches, and installing perforated pipes that allow effluent to flow evenly into the surrounding soil. Proper installation ensures that wastewater is effectively treated and safely absorbed, reducing the risk of system failure or contamination. Experienced service providers assess the property’s layout and soil conditions to design and install a drain field that functions efficiently over time.

These services help address common issues associated with septic systems, such as backups, foul odors, or standing water near the drain field area. When a drain field is improperly installed or becomes clogged or damaged, it can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Installing a new drain field or replacing an existing one can resolve these problems, ensuring the septic system operates reliably. Professional installation also helps prevent early system failure caused by poor site assessment or inadequate design, promoting long-term performance.

Properties that typically require drain field installation services include rural homes, ranches, or properties without access to municipal sewer systems. These properties rely on septic systems for wastewater management, making a properly functioning drain field essential for health and sanitation. Additionally, some commercial properties or developments in areas with limited sewer infrastructure may also utilize septic systems with custom drain fields. The size and design of the drain field are tailored to the property’s specific needs, soil characteristics, and usage demands.

The overview below groups typical Drain Field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Leandro,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a drain field typically ranges from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on site size and soil conditions. Larger systems or difficult terrain can increase expenses beyond this range.

Material Expenses - Materials such as gravel, piping, and fabric usually contribute $1,000 to $3,000 to the total cost. The choice of high-quality or specialized materials can affect overall expenses.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for drain field installation generally fall between $1,500 and $4,000, influenced by project complexity and local labor rates. More extensive or complicated installations tend to be at the higher end of this range.

Permitting and Additional Fees - Permit costs and site assessments can add $200 to $1,000 to the project budget. These fees vary based on local regulations and specific site requ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a drain field? A drain field is an underground system that disperses treated wastewater from a septic tank into the soil, helping to prevent sewage backups and environmental contamination.

How long does a drain field installation typically take? The duration of installation can vary depending on the size and complexity of the system, but it generally takes several days to complete.

What factors influence the cost of installing a drain field? Costs are affected by soil conditions, the size of the system, local regulations, and site accessibility, among other factors.

Are there different types of drain fields available? Yes, common types include conventional gravel and pipe systems, as well as alternative options like mound systems or chamber systems, depending on site conditions.

How can I determine if my property needs a new drain field? Signs such as persistent backups, slow drains, or wet areas near the septic system may indicate the need for a new drain field, but a professional assessment is recommended.
